🏆 2024 Huawei Developer Competition — North Africa Region Champion

The Smart
Field Platform
for Modern
Farmers

Hurudza is an integrated smart farming platform combining a cross-platform mobile & web app with custom IoT devices — digitizing and optimizing agriculture through AI, cloud, and real-time data.

🥇

North Africa
Regional 1st

HDC

Huawei Global
Finals 2024

IoT

Custom ESP32
Prototype

IoT · ESP32 Huawei Cloud · ECS ModelArts · AI React Native Flask · Python ResNet · CV NPK · Soil Sensors CodeArts · CI/CD IoT · ESP32 Huawei Cloud · ECS ModelArts · AI React Native Flask · Python ResNet · CV NPK · Soil Sensors CodeArts · CI/CD
Who We Are

Bridging the gap
between farming &
technology

Octadot is an innovative AgriTech company based in Oran, Algeria. Our flagship project Hurudza is a cross-platform smart farming solution that integrates IoT hardware, artificial intelligence, and cloud computing to help farmers make data-driven decisions — from soil analysis to marketplace access.

The name "Hurudza" means "to farm" in Shona, reflecting our mission to serve agricultural communities across Africa and beyond.

🇩🇿 Algeria AgriTech / Smart Farming contact@octadot.net

The Problem We Solve

🌱

Inefficient Farm Monitoring

Farmers lack real-time, actionable data on soil, weather, and crops — leading to reactive responses and lower yields.

📦

Fragmented Supply Chain

Difficulty accessing markets, limited financial tools, and lack of tailored guidance hinder profitability.

💧

Resource Waste & Climate Risk

Inefficient water usage, weather dependency, and soil degradation threaten food security across Africa.

🌍

Impact Areas

Sub-Saharan Africa · South Asia · Emerging economies

🎯

Our Mission

Empower smallholder farmers with data-driven insights

How It Works

IoT Sensors

Data Collection

Network

Wireless Transmission

Huawei Cloud

Storage & Processing

AI Insights

Recommendations

App Interface

Mobile & Web

Platform

Everything a farmer needs,
in one platform

An integrated ecosystem of IoT hardware, AI models, and intuitive dashboards that transform raw field data into actionable intelligence.

Hurudza Dashboard

Real-Time Monitoring

Live sensor readings for soil moisture, pH, NPK levels, temperature, humidity, air quality, water level, and rainfall — updated every 30 seconds.

AI Decision Support

Four ML models: Crop Recommendation (Gaussian Naïve Bayes), Irrigation Scheduling (Decision Tree), Plant Disease Detection (ResNet), and Fertilizer Optimization.

Huawei Cloud Backend

Elastic Cloud Server (ECS), Object Storage (OBS), Relational Database (RDS/MySQL), Redis caching, ModelArts for AI training, and CodeArts for CI/CD pipelines.

Mobile App (React Native)

Cross-platform app for iOS & Android. Features weather display, crop recommendations, plant disease detection by photo, irrigation advice, and fertilizer control.

Farmer Marketplace

An integrated marketplace for farmers to buy and sell produce, seeds, and equipment — connecting rural communities to buyers and cooperatives directly.

Business Model

Subscription-based access for farmers with tiered pricing. Marketplace transaction fees, NGO/government partnerships, and agricultural data sales generate continuous revenue.

Sample IoT Readings — Live Sensor Data

Parameter Value Parameter Value
Nitrogen (N)195.3 mg/kgSoil Temperature25.9 °C
Phosphorus (P)49.5 mg/kgEnv. Temperature18.9 °C
Potassium (K)24.0 mg/kgHumidity68.9 %
Soil pH6.99Water Level64.3 cm
Moisture36.1 %Air Quality453.6 ppm
Pressure1039.8 hPaLight72,040 lux

Data transmitted to Huawei Cloud every 30 seconds via ESP32 WiFi module

IoT Hardware

Custom-built
ESP32 prototype
from scratch

The Hurudza IoT device is a fully custom-built unit using an ESP32 microcontroller and a suite of environmental and soil sensors. It started as a breadboard prototype and evolved into a 3D-printed enclosure with a custom-designed PCB.

🔬

Soil Sensors (NPK)

RS485 NPK sensor via transceiver for Nitrogen, Phosphorus, and Potassium readings with MQ135 air quality sensor

🌡️

Environmental Sensors

BME280 for temperature, humidity & pressure · Water level sensor · Rainfall sensor · LDR light sensor · GPS NEO-6M

📟

LCD Display + Custom PCB

On-device LCD display for local readings · Custom PCB designed in KiCad · 3D-printed enclosure with solar power support

Electronic Schematic

Circuit schematic — ESP32 + sensors + RS485 + LCD (5V DC)

Hurudza Prototype
PCB Diagram
PCB 3D Top
PCB 3D Bottom

PCB schematic (KiCad) · 3D renders — top & bottom layers

Prototype Evolution

v1 — Breadboard Prototype

All sensors wired on breadboard, initial firmware & data transmission test

v2 — 3D-Printed Enclosure

Custom black housing with LCD cutout, cleaner wiring, field-deployable form

v3 — Custom PCB (KiCad)

Full PCB design with ESP32, GPS, BME280, RS485, SME connectors, LDR integration

Competition Journey

From Oran to China

The Octadot team's journey through the Huawei Developer Competition 2024 — from the regional pitch to the Global Awards Ceremony at HDC.2025 in Shenzhen.

Step 1

Algeria Regional Pitch

Octadot (Team 6) presented Hurudza at the HDC Algeria 2024 regional selection — competing against the best Algerian tech teams.

Step 2

North Africa Regional Final

Competed against top teams from Algeria, Egypt, Morocco, and Ethiopia. Octadot claimed First Prize — the highest award.

Step 3

National Award Ceremony

Officially recognized and awarded by Huawei at the national ceremony — receiving prizes and certificates from Huawei leadership.

Step 4

Global Finals — HDC.2025

Invited to Shenzhen, China for the Huawei Developer Competition 2024 Global Awards Ceremony — representing North Africa on the world stage.

Official Regional Results — North Africa Final

Country Team Award
🇩🇿 Algeria Octadot Team ★ 🥇 First Prize
🇪🇬 Egypt Manetho Second Prize
🇪🇬 Egypt Cloudy Second Prize
🇲🇦 Morocco TechLeads Third Prize
🇪🇬 Egypt GS Team Third Prize
🇪🇹 Ethiopia Innovate Fusion Third Prize

Competition Gallery

HDC Algeria 2024

HDC Algeria 2024 — Octadot Team

Pitch Day

Pitch Day — Presenting Hurudza at Huawei HQ

First Prize Award

🏆 First Prize — North Africa Regional Ceremony

National Competition Ceremony

National Awards Ceremony — Huawei leadership

National Competition

HDC National Competition stage

Global Awards Ceremony

HDC 2024 Global Awards Ceremony — Shenzhen, China

HDC 2025 China

🌏 HDC.2025 — Huawei Developer Conference, China

Hurudza represented North Africa at the Global Finals in Shenzhen

Live Demos

See Hurudza in action

Watch the IoT prototype collecting real soil data and the full platform dashboard in action.

IoT Prototype

Soil Sensor Live Readings

Watch the ESP32-based Hurudza device reading NPK, pH, soil humidity, temperature, and environmental data — transmitted live to the cloud dashboard.

Web Platform

Dashboard & Analytics

Explore the Hurudza web dashboard with real-time charts, sensor analytics, AI-driven crop recommendations, and plant disease detection.

🎬 Competition Experience

The Octadot team's full journey through the Huawei Developer Competition — pitches, ceremony, and the trip to China for HDC.2025

AI & Machine Learning

Four AI models,
one decision engine

🌾

Crop Recommendation

Gaussian Naïve Bayes

Recommends optimal crops based on NPK, pH, rainfall, temperature & humidity

💧

Irrigation Scheduling

Decision Tree Classifier

Determines optimal irrigation ON/OFF decisions with 99.3% accuracy on test data

🔍

Plant Disease Detection

ResNet (Deep Learning)

Image classification trained on the New Plant Diseases Dataset — 60 epochs, ~85% validation accuracy

🧪

Fertilizer Optimization

Random Forest Classifier

Recommends fertilizer type and quantities based on soil composition and crop type

Huawei Cloud Services Used

☁️

ECS + VPC

Elastic Cloud Server · Virtual Private Cloud

🗄️

RDS / MySQL

Relational Database — hurudza-db (AF-Cairo)

📦

OBS

Object Storage — sensor logs, images, ML datasets

🤖

ModelArts

AI model training & deployment (GPU: Ant03 · 24 vCPU)

🔄

CodeArts

CI/CD pipelines · Automated build, test & deploy

Redis (DCS)

Distributed cache layer for fast data access

Business Value

A scalable model
for sustainable farming

Subscription Revenue Model

Farmers subscribe for tiered access to real-time data, AI insights, and marketplace — generating recurring revenue at scale.

NGO & Government Partnerships

Subsidy programs with agricultural ministries and NGOs focused on food security across Africa make adoption accessible.

Agricultural Data Sales

Anonymized soil and meteorological datasets sold to research institutions, seed companies, and policy makers.

Market Expansion

Targeting Sub-Saharan Africa, South Asia, and other emerging agricultural economies facing climate change and resource scarcity.

40%

Potential resource waste reduction

99%

Irrigation model accuracy

30s

Sensor data update interval

5+

Huawei Cloud services integrated

🤝 Investment Opportunity

Octadot is seeking strategic investment and partnerships to accelerate the development and deployment of the Hurudza system. Funds will be directed toward IoT hardware production, AI model refinement, market penetration in Africa, and platform scaling.

Get in Touch →
FAQ

Common Questions

The Hurudza prototype includes: NPK soil sensor (via RS485 transceiver), MQ135 air quality sensor, Water-5 moisture sensor, BME280 (temperature, humidity, pressure), GPS NEO-6M module, LDR light sensor, rainfall sensor, and an I²C LCD display — all controlled by an ESP32 microcontroller running at 5V DC.

Hurudza leverages: Elastic Cloud Server (ECS) for the Flask backend hosted at 101.46.71.38, Virtual Private Cloud (VPC) for network security, Object Storage (OBS) for datasets and images, Relational Database Service (RDS/MySQL) for structured data, ModelArts for AI training and deployment, CodeArts for CI/CD pipelines, and Redis (DCS) as a distributed cache layer.

The Decision Tree irrigation classifier achieves ~99.3% accuracy (OFF: 9302/9305, ON: 10694/10695 correctly classified). The Gaussian Naïve Bayes crop recommendation model achieves near-perfect accuracy across 22 crop classes. The ResNet plant disease detection model reaches ~85% validation accuracy after 60 training epochs on the New Plant Diseases Dataset.

Yes. Octadot is actively seeking strategic investors, NGO partners, government agricultural bodies, and distribution channels. We offer tailored pilot programs for agricultural cooperatives and are open to licensing discussions. Reach us at contact@octadot.net to start the conversation.

Octadot's team (BouKhiar Naima) won First Prize at the 2024 Huawei Developer Competition North Africa Regional Final, beating teams from Algeria, Egypt, Morocco, and Ethiopia. They then represented North Africa at the Global Awards Ceremony at HDC.2025 in Shenzhen, China.

The Team

Meet Octadot

The two-person team from Oran, Algeria who built Hurudza from a breadboard prototype to a world-stage finalist.

BN

BouKhiar Naima

Founder / CTO · Octadot

IoT Hardware & Software — designed the ESP32 prototype and custom PCB

TF

Tlemcani Farah

Led the Huawei Cloud integration and AI model training on ModelArts

Award at HDC.2025 — China

Both team members attended the Huawei Developer Conference 2025 in Shenzhen as global finalists, representing Algeria and North Africa on the world stage.

🏆 North Africa HDC 2024 Champion · HDC.2025 Global Finalist

Let's grow the
future of farming
together

Whether you're an investor, agricultural organization, government body, or a farmer — we'd love to hear from you.

💼

Investors

Strategic investment to scale IoT production and platform globally

🤝

Partners & NGOs

Collaborate to deploy Hurudza in agricultural communities across Africa

🌱

Farmers

Join the pilot program and get early access to the Hurudza platform